Show I AGENTS WILL REPORT ON DRY FARM LANDS Chief George E. Hair of the tenth field division of tho p:enural land office Is busily engaged at tho present time in starting the special ascius out over the varfous counties for the purpose of reporting re-porting on tho dry-farming lands which arc to be opened in Utah. Special Agent II. V. Campbell has gone to foUIard county and W. H. Petley leaves today for Tiox Wider county. On Saturday Satur-day Chief Hair will leave for Tooele coun-i coun-i Sneaking of those people who know of lands in any part of the state on which they would like to file. Chief Ilair said it was of the utmost importance to r.heni Hint they scud in the township and range number of such lands to tho office, at Salt "Lake, when the information would be sent on to the secretary of Hie Inferior, In-ferior, who would then designate it as dry-farming land or not, as the case inlsht be. |
